Episode #110 features a discussion about coming together to create a centralized repository of resource slides from which people can draw upon to create their own Strategy-A-Day Calendar.

This episode also features a bumper from Amy Braddock, the assistive technology specialist for West Fargo Public Schools in North Dakota

A.T.TIPS in this Episode –

A.T.TIP #319 – Kent ISD’s Strategy-A-Day Calendar in Grand Rapids, Michigan.

A.T.TIP #320 – The Iowa Center for Assistive Technology Education and Research’s ongoing Tip of the Day images accessible from http://bit.ly/icater and from their daily Twitter feed at http://twitter.com/IOWA_iCATER.

A.T.TIP #321 – The Crowd-Sourced, Open Source Strategy-A-Day Calendar
